• Sponsors conducting a high number of trials and using 5-6 data sources can expect longer cycle times while they are researching or planning a formal data strategy; once sponsors implement a formal data strategy, database lock cycle times decrease by ~ 2 days. • Sponsors who have implemented a formal data strategy perceive their analytics critical capabilities to be more fully developed and mature. • Sponsors using a data hub / lake rate themselves as more mature in all critical capabilities with use of dashboards and visual exploration having statistically significant differences compared to those not using a data hub / lake.

Number of Days • LPLV to DBL cycle times have increased about 6 days overall since the previous study in 2017 • Large sponsors had the highest increase in LPLV to DBL (32%) since the previous study in 2017 *Study examining current and evolving EDC and clinical data usage practices across the drug development enterprise. Survey contained 22 questions, was open for 10 weeks, and garnered 257 completed responses from mostly sponsor organizations (75%)
